Description

Discover Xunantunich, one of Belize’s most iconic Maya archaeological sites, nestled on a scenic ridge above the Mopan River near the Guatemalan border. Known as the “Maiden of the Rock” or “Stone Woman,” this ancient city offers a fascinating glimpse into Classic Maya civilization. Explore its most impressive landmarks, including El Castillo—one of the tallest structures in Belize—Structure A1, and the ceremonial Maya ball court. A must-visit for history lovers and adventurers alike, Xunantunich ranks among the top 10 Maya sites in Belize. Start with a half-hour guided hike through the verdant Belizean rainforest, uncovering the rich flora and fauna that thrive in this ecosystem. The hike concludes with a delightful tubing journey down the cool, clear waters of the Cave Branch River, providing a refreshing escape from the tropical heat. Embark on a tube float equipped with life vests and helmets. Prioritizing safety, this adventure takes you through what the Maya revered as the underworld, Xibalba, or the “Place of Fear,” akin to their concept of hell. After this tour, you can claim that you’ve been to hell and back. For thrill-seekers, this one-hour zip line tour offers an adrenaline-pumping experience as you glide through the pristine rainforest canopy. The highlight is the largest zip line in the area, stretching 1,000 feet in length and soaring 140 feet above the forest floor, offering breathtaking views and a rush unlike any other.
